The Intel Core i3-2330M processor, released in 2011, uses Intel® HD Graphics 3000. Because this is a 2nd Gen processor, it uses older drivers that are best supported on Windows 7, 8, or 10. 1. Identify Your Current Driver Before updating, check if you actually need to. Press Windows Key + X and select Device Manager. Expand Display adapters. Right-click Intel® HD Graphics 3000 and select Properties. Go to the Driver tab to see the version and date. 2. Download the Driver
